Design with Depth: Styles That Suit Every Space

The modern approach to wood paneling is all about customization. With a broad range of profiles, finishes, and materials, you can create moods that range from coastal calm to urban chic. Here are some popular styles:

  • Shiplap: Clean and horizontal, perfect for light-filled, beach-inspired interiors.
  • Beadboard: Adds vintage charm, often used in bathrooms or cottage-style kitchens.
  • Reclaimed Wood: Infuses spaces with warmth, sustainability, and a story.
  • Flat Panels: Sleek and understated, great for Scandinavian or contemporary schemes.

Function Meets Form: The Practical Benefits of Wood Paneling

Wood paneling doesn’t just elevate your walls visually—it also enhances how your space feels and performs:

  • Thermal Insulation: Natural wood helps regulate indoor temperatures, reducing energy needs.
  • Sound Absorption: Especially in open-plan layouts, paneling helps minimize echo and ambient noise.
  • Durability: Engineered and treated wood panels withstand everyday wear better than painted drywall.
  • Concealment: Ideal for hiding uneven walls, wires, or plumbing while maintaining a seamless finish.

Each type of paneling brings unique design and functional value:

  • Tongue and Groove: Interlocking panels suited for walls and ceilings with clean transitions.
  • Wainscoting: Decorative lower-wall treatments that add protection and sophistication.
  • Board and Batten: Alternating vertical boards and thin battens for bold, architectural lines.
  • Slatted Panels: Vertical or horizontal slats that offer modern separation without bulk.

Low Maintenance, High Impact

Another bonus? Wood panel walls are easy to care for. Unlike painted surfaces that scuff or wallpaper that peels, wood requires only a quick dust or wipe. Pre-finished and moisture-resistant options are perfect for high-traffic or high-humidity zones like mudrooms, kitchens, and bathrooms.

Wood Paneling FAQs

Is wood paneling still in style? Yes! Modern materials and finishes have brought paneling into the 21st century. It’s now a coveted feature in high-end and minimalist homes alike.

Can it be used in wet spaces like bathrooms? Absolutely—with the right preparation. Choose moisture-resistant wood or sealed composite options.

How long will it last? With proper care, quality wood paneling can last decades. In fact, it often gets better with age, developing a rich patina.

Can I install it myself? Many options—like tongue-and-groove or peel-and-stick panels—are DIY-friendly. More intricate designs may require a pro.

Is it costly? Costs vary based on the wood species, size, and finish. Reclaimed wood is often affordable and environmentally conscious, while exotic hardwoods carry a premium.
